May 23, 2023 · To create a project risk register, follow six basic steps: gather relevant past documents, gather input, enter potential risks into the risk register, prioritize risks based on risk score, assign an owner to each risk, and continually update the register. Creating a risk register is an important early part of project risk analysis.

  6. Mar 23, 2024 · A risk register is a document used in project management to identify, assess, and manage potential risks that could affect the successful delivery of a project. The risk register typically includes information such as the nature of the risk, its potential impact, the likelihood of occurrence, and planned responses.
